For experienced technicians, PC Check also supports command-line options, which can be used to automate and customize the testing process. However, because PC Check Self-Boot does not provide a standard command prompt, command-line options must be written to a file named . The system is then rebooted to allow PC Check to read and use the commands. It is recommended to use PC Check's own System File Editor to create this file. An example command line might be: /JF ERRORS.FIL /BD /BS . This logs failed tests into a file called ERRORS.FIL , displays the final outcome on a Status Indicator Box (if present), and exits when finished. For burn-in testing, the CMDLINE.TXT file must reference an additional burn-in file containing the desired set of repeatable tests.

Eurosoft PC-Check is a professional-grade diagnostic software suite developed by Eurosoft (UK) Ltd., a company that has been a key player in the computer testing industry since 1980. Unlike standard software utilities that run within an operating system (OS) like Windows, PC-Check is designed to run in a "self-booting" environment. This "bare-metal" approach allows it to directly access and test PC hardware components without any interference from the OS, its drivers, or other software that might mask underlying issues.
